Trying to find out Cat scrap Value from recycle place in NJ
 
Hi Everyone,

I tried to post this in the exhaust area but no replies. Just about finished parting out my 2003 Honda Accord EXL V6. Question, does anyone know how much I can get from a recycle place for this Accords Catalytic Convertor? Meaning its scrap value.Trying to see if it is worth it to cut it out before I call a tow company to tow away my Accord.

JimBlake 11-16-2018 12:40 PM

I saw this in the other section too, but have no idea how to answer. In some states it's illegal to buy/sell used catalytic converters, apparently trying to remove the market for people to go stealing them off of cars. I have no idea how NJ goes in that respect.
